Born in Harrisburg, on December 24, 1925, she was the daughter of the late William and Mary Hill Smith.
Dottie was a salesclerk at the former Bowman's Department Store, Harrisburg, but she was most proud of serving with the Harrisburg Auxiliary Police Women during World War II. Dottie was a graduate of the former John Harris High School. She was a former member of First Christian Church, Lemoyne. Dottie enjoyed traveling and shopping.
She was preceded in death by her husband, Jack H. Bowers, on October 5, 1995; a great grandson, Scott Garis, Jr.; a sister and brother-in-law, Shirley and Robert Nickols; and a brother and sister-in-law, Charles and Evelyn Smith.
Dottie is survived by one son, Harold D. Bowers husband of Leslie of Camp Hill; three granddaughters, Nichole Collins fiancée of Joseph Zito, Tracy Constantine wife of Craig, and Stacy Snyder wife of Andrew; two great grandchildren, Leanna Garis and Thomas Collins; two brothers, Leon Smith husband of Sally of Lemoyne, and Robert Smith wife of Helen of Harrisburg; one sister, Ida Waypa of Wisconsin; and several nieces and nephews.
Funeral service will be held Friday, July 19, 2013, at 11:30 AM in the Trefz & Bowser Funeral Home, Inc. 114 West Main Street, Hummelstown. Interment will be in the Hummelstown Cemetery. Friends are invited to visit with the family Friday from 10:30 AM until time of the service.
